THE GREEK REVERSE

TURKISH EXAGGERATION ACCORDING TO GREEKS IN LONDON. ARMY SAID TO BE INTACT. By Telegraph—Press As6n.—Copyright. Australian and N.Z. Came Association. (Received August 31, 5.5 p.m.) LONDON, August 31. The Greek authoritien iu London are busy with propaganda. They claim that the Turks are greatly exaggerating the result of the battle. While admitting that the two principal wings of the Greek army have no longer a direct railway communication, it is stated that they remain in contact with each other. Recalling the claim that the Greeks occupied Smyrna by Allied instructions, the authorities insist that their forces are retained in Asia Minor because they are the sole protectors of the Christian population. The Greeks declare that if tbe troops are withdrawn the Christians will he left to a terrible fate, because the Allied Powers do not provide an alternative protection. FRENCH {ARTILLERY USED. (Received August 31, 5.5 p.m.) LONDON, August 30. A Greek communique declares that the Kemalists are using French artillery, and have an abundance of munitions.
